Pro forma income statement At the end of last year, Roberts Inc. reported the following income statement in millions

Sales 3,000 Operating costs excl depreciation 2,450 EBITDA 550 Deprec. 250 EBIT 300 Interest 125 EBT 175 Taxes%40 70 Net Income 105

Looking ahead Year end sales are expected to be %10 higher than the 3billion

Year end operating costs exclud deprec are expected to equal %80 of yr end sales

Depreciation is expected to increase at same rates as sales

Interest costs same

Tax rate same at %40

On this info what will be the forecast for Roberts year end net income?
